Product description

The Waldorf bedside by R&Y Augousti is a modern and elegant piece. This bedside table has subtle geometry with its asymmetric cream shagreen overlay. The piece is completely inlaid in cream shagreen, but includes subtle details in bronze patina brass including the metal indentation border on the top overlay and the bottom shelf, adding another element of luxury. The drawers are inlaid in gemelina wood. This bedside table includes two drawers and a bronze-patina brass bottom shelf. Custom color/sizing available on request.

The finish of the shagreen is authentic as it is hand-dyed by our artisans and the designer calls this finish 'antique natural' shagreen.

63 x 44 x 60cm

All R&Y Augousti pieces are handmade by artisans, ultimately making each piece unique.

Wipe clean with soft dry cloth.

Acclaimed design duo Ria & Yiouri Augousti have established themselves since the 1990’s as pioneers of modern-vintage style through their luxurious art-deco inspired collections.

The Paris based label has distinguished themselves since their launch, with their iconic use of shagreen mixed with brass and other exotic materials. All furniture is handcrafted by skilled artisans, ultimately making each piece unique. 

 

*All shagreen-covered items should be kept out of direct sunlight, colour variants may occur on the stingray and other exotic finishes, but this showcases the Parisian label's commitment to creating authentic luxurious products using natural components.
